Due to the global economic slowdown, we were benefiting from relatively low oil prices. But because of the instability of the Middle East and the slowing of the global economy we are seeing oil prices fall. But when the global economy fully recovers, you can expect the price of gas to keep rising.

One of the key principles of economics is the law of comparative advantage. In view the President Obama's hold on the Keystone Pipeline project and our memory of the oil spill in the Gulf of Mexico a few years ago, I want you to see yourself as an economic adviser to the U.S. Congress and the president, and in your initial opinion present your advice as to what they should do or not do. Support your argument with economic principles including the concept of comparative advantage. Noteworthy is the value of the dollar on the exchange markets. Oil is bought and sold globally in U.S. dollars; so all countries must buy dollars on the exchange markets to buy oil. Effectively, the value of the dollar to another nation’s currency could make oil more expensive or less expensive for that nation depending on the exchange rate when a purchase is made.
